Methyl 1-methyl-4-phenylpiperidine-4-carboxylate) hydrochloride
CAS :Produit contrôlé<p>Methyl 1-methyl-4-phenylpiperidine-4-carboxylate hydrochloride is a drug product that belongs to the group of synthetic compounds. It has been used for research and development, as an analytical standard, and as a pharmacopoeia impurity. This drug product is metabolized in the liver to form methyl 1-methyl-4-(1H)-pyridinium piperidinium carboxylate (MMPP) and then excreted in urine. Methyl 1-methyl-4-(1H)-pyridinium piperidinium carboxylate can be used as a urinary metabolite marker for this compound.</p>Formule :C14H19NO2·HClDegré de pureté :Min. 95%Masse moléculaire :269.77 g/mol
